1
ответ

при парсинге идентификатора/имен процесса от/proc распараллельте идентификаторы

Когда я анализирую идентификаторы процесса от/proc, очевидно, каждый поток процесса получает свой собственный идентификатор. И я понимаю, что все потоки в том же самом процессе могут быть собраны от/proc/$ {pid}/task/. Но мой...
08.06.2011
1
ответ

удаление 'файла' под/proc или/dev

Я использую установку cowdancer/debootstrap для генерации chroot. Конечно, поскольку я выполняю итерации, я генерирую некоторые chroot конфигурации, которые плохи. Я оказался в неловком положении, где я имею...
03.06.2011
0
ответов

Есть ли какая-либо причина, по которой /proc/ */cmdline доступен для чтения всему миру -?

Возможно, сегодня я еще не выпил достаточно кофе, но я не могу вспомнить или придумать какую-либо причину, по которой /proc/PID/cmdline должен быть -доступным для чтения -всему миру, в конце концов, /proc/PID/ окружающая среда не является. Сделать его дос
18.10.2021
0
ответов

Точка монтирования Linux в виртуальной файловой системе proc?

Меня попросили перенести этот вопрос сюда из stackoverflow. Я сделал форк репозитория guitmz memrun (для asm and go ). Я предоставил memrun и memfd _create для C в моей вилке :.https://github.com/Hermann-SW/memrun?organization=Hermann-SW&organization=
06.10.2021
0
ответов

захватить команды из каждого PID и рассчитать потребление памяти командой в GIGA (с помощью способа сортировки)

Я использую этот подход, чтобы проверить команды, которые потребляют память от высокого до низкого уровня на Linux RedHat. Я написал этот подход как 1024/1024, чтобы получить значения в GIGA пс -...
01.08.2021
0
ответов

Получить неразрешенный pwd оболочки из другого процесса

Я столкнулся с проблемой, когда мне нужно получить неразрешенную символическую ссылку процесса оболочки. Например, при наличии символической ссылки ~/link -> ~/actual, если bash запускается с $PWD, равным ~/link, мне нужно получить это...
22.07.2021
0
ответов

Процесс монтирования с параметром hidepid не скрывает процессы, как ожидалось, почему?

У меня есть обычная proc fs, смонтированная в /proc по умолчанию. (Я являюсь пользователем root для всех следующих команд )Я снова монтирую то же самое в другом месте с опцией hidepid, установленной так :монтировать -t проц -о...
01.04.2021
0
ответов

Я хочу отобразить определенную информацию из /proc/cpuinfo

Я хочу показать количество ЦП, производителя ЦП и модель ЦП. Я использовал cat /proc/cpuinfo, чтобы показать файл cpuinfo. однако я хочу отображать только необходимую информацию. например. процессор...
15.02.2021
0
ответов

Bind -mount и cryptsetup приводят к усечению корневого -пути в /proc/self/mountinfo

У меня есть зашифрованный контейнер, содержащий файловую систему ext4 с подкаталогом, который смонтирован -позже. Если я взгляну на /proc/self/mountinfo, корневой каталог -для монтирования...
22.01.2021
0
ответов

Как получить доступ к файлу /proc/ (procfs )через SSHFS

Использование компьютера с Ubuntu 16.04 (никаких предложений по обновлению, пожалуйста )Я смонтировал /proc/ на своем Raspberry Pi 3B + (ядро ​​Linux версии 4.19.88 )через SSHFS :sshfspi@192.168.0.4 :/proc ~/procAtPi лс -ла ~/...
20.01.2021
0
ответов

Получение имени исполняемого файла в Linux из /proc/ и определение его усечения

Имя исполняемого файла linux может быть прочитано по-разному. Читая /proc/[pid]/comm, который содержит строку, которая усекается после достижения 16 символов или TASK _COMM _LEN. Читая /proc/[pid]/...
19.01.2021
0
ответов

Китайские иероглифы в одном из файлов

Я обнаружил несколько китайских иероглифов в одном из файлов на Linux Mint 20.1. Файл -/proc/1/cmdline Китайские иероглифы -猯楢⽮湩瑩猀汰獡h Но когда я открываю тот же файл в терминале с помощью команды less, он показывает :/...
18.01.2021
0
ответов

Содержит ли /proc/ tid?

У меня есть процесс с идентификатором 1234. Этот процесс содержит поток с идентификатором 1235. Когда я использую ls -l /proc, я вижу только pid (1234 ), но когда я открываю файл состояния потока с помощью cat /proc/1235/status, я вижу данные. Почему...
07.09.2020
0
ответов

Эмулировать папку /proc

У меня есть программа, которая использует несколько неприятных алгоритмов, чтобы определить, работает ли она в док-контейнере или нет. Одним из примеров является то, что он сканирует /proc/1/cgroup на наличие некорневых путей (, то есть /docker/SOME -UUID
30.07.2020
0
ответов

Что может сделать отладчик с помощью /proc, чего нельзя сделать с помощью ptrace?

В статье Википедии о ptrace говорится :Связь между контроллером и целью осуществляется с помощью повторных вызовов ptrace, при этом между двумя (...
05.07.2020
0
ответов

Как восстановить файлы, удаленные из /usr/bin?

TL;DR внизу. Справочная информация. На моем рабочем сервере CentOS 6.10 произошло следующее. Я использовал терминальную программу на основе браузера для запуска программы Midnight Commander, которая представляет собой консоль-...
30.05.2020
0
ответов

Заставляет ли ядро ​​stats /proc/PID/stat генерировать содержимое, чтобы возвращался размер файла?

Я реализую альтернативу top и подумал, что должен предварительно выделить буфер соответствующего размера для хранения прочитанного содержимого /proc/PID/stat. Однако, зная, что это псевдо файловая система...
26.05.2020
0
ответов

autofs --принудительное размонтирование /proc

Исторически я видел, что autofs попадает в ситуации, когда systemctl перезапуск autofs зависает на неопределенный срок из-за устаревших дескрипторов nfs. В результате я использовал принудительную опцию --, чтобы заставить autofs воспроизводить...
20.05.2020
0
ответов

Как лучше всего ограничить /proc fs от злоумышленников (linux)?

Я пытаюсь сделать ограничение для procfs, например, только определенные группы участников могут выполнять операции чтения и записи. В документе ядра говорится, что мы можем сделать это, установив hidepid и gid в /etc/fstab. Это ...
14.03.2020
0
ответов

Как проверить номер устройства в `/proc/1/ns/{ns}`?

Как проверить номер устройства в /proc/1/ns/{ns}? Я прочитал код для библиотеки Go (см. ниже), в котором говорится, что можно определить, находится ли контейнер в пространстве имен хоста...
04.03.2020
0
ответов

inotifywait не отвечает на изменения в /proc/mounts

Я пытаюсь получить уведомление о состоянии проблемного монтирования sshfs Я попробовал два сценария bash, пока inotifywait -e modify /proc/mounts; do echo "modified" done и inotifywait -m /...
03.03.2020
0
ответов

Почему области виртуальной памяти для одной и той же программы различны при каждом запуске?

Я изучаю сопоставление областей памяти виртуальной памяти в Linux. Исполняемый файл представляет собой простую программу подсчета. Когда запущены два экземпляра программы, /proc/... отображаются следующие отображения:
01.01.2020
0
ответов

Какой (39) процессор представлен в файле /proc/[pid[/stat]?

В соответствии с procfs man /proc/[pid]/stat (39) процессор %d (начиная с Linux 2.2.8) номер процессора, на котором выполнялся последний раз. Я вижу, для некоторых задач есть значение -1 $ cat /proc/1185/task/...
17.07.2019
0
ответов

В каких единицах указаны значения в / proc / partitions и / sys / dev / block / / size?

У меня есть образец информации о блоке emmc с устройства Android Из / proc / partitions major minor #blocks name 179 1 5120 mmcblk0p1 Используя свой небольшой интеллект, я предполагаю, что / proc / partitions ...
17.04.2019
0
ответов

Как прочитать информацию о подключении к Wi-Fi из proc - net? [дубликат]

Есть ли способ получить информацию о моем текущем WiFi-соединении на моем Android? Такая информация, как название сети Wi-Fi, время начала подключения, продолжительность подключения и т. д.? Я заглянул внутрь...
23.12.2018
0
ответов

Лучший способ программного определения текущего хоста (по аппаратным характеристикам)

У меня есть жесткий диск с установленным на нем Linux, который мне нравится загружать с разных физических компьютеров. Мой вопрос заключается в том, можно ли программно определить, на каком компьютере установлен диск ...
15.09.2018
0
ответов

Что на самом деле «ошибки» / ProC / CPUINFO на самом деле Показать?

На системе простирания и тестирования и тестирования Debian с текущим ядром и установленным микрокодом я все еще вижу, как олицетворение и призрак, перечисленные как ошибки в / proc / cpuinfo. Тем не менее, запустив спектр-талдадада -...
16.07.2018
0
ответов

Что касается / proc / interrupts, что такое MIS и ERR?

Играем с просмотром / proc / interrupts. В выводе ниже показаны ERR и MIS в строках 26 и 27 соответственно. Что это такое и почему у них есть счетчики (хотя и равные нулю) для CPU0, но нет других, так как ...
17.03.2018
0
ответов

TracerPID-ди процесстен кантип жашырсам болот?

Мен Linuxтагы SQL Server TracerPID үчүн / proc / self / status текшерип жатат, эгерде ал жок болсо, анда 0 өлүп жатат. Мен аны сынап көргүм келет. Ойноп отуруп, мына бул стресс, ... көп нерселер openat (...
01.02.2018
0
ответов

Можете ли вы найти дескриптор файла, принадлежащий другому процессу как root?

Существует метод поиска с помощью дескриптора файла в C, int fseek (FILE * stream, long offset, int wherence ); В fdinfo также есть файл для каждого дескриптора файла, cat / proc / self / fdinfo / 2 pos: 0 flags: ...
25.01.2018